siri g.

I've ordered from this place several times, and it's become one of my go-to spots whenever I'm craving Indian street food. That said, I've learned that it can be a bit hit or miss depending on what you order. My absolute favorites are the peri peri fries and the cheese vada pav, I've ordered both multiple times, and they always hit the spot. The fries have the perfect amount of spice, and the cheese vada pav is just so satisfying. The papdi chaat was also really good. It was packed well for takeout with all the chutneys kept separate, so everything stayed fresh until I got home. The paneer sandwich had good flavor, but I personally found it a little too greasy. As for the Schezwan noodles, they were freshly made, but the flavor just wasn't for me. I keep coming back because the dishes I love are really good, even if not everything on the menu is a winner for me.

Nikhil U.

Review only for the few things we ate - Vada pav - one of the decent ones ive had in the US. The chutney in the pav was on point. I think its too expensive though. Cheese Pav bhaji - Again a decent dish. More spicy than normally served, but i liked it this way. Chilli garlic bhakri pizza - This was great. Spicy, cruncy base and loads of cheese. Chickoo milkshake - was delighted to see this on the menu. It wasnt overly sweet and pretty good.
